I started creating my Fabric Revival blankets in 2020 as a way to make unique yarn and clean out my closet of old linens. There were so many rabbit holes I went down learning about textiles, and where they end up at the end of their life. It soon became an environmental justice passion project as I learned about the multitude of textiles that enter the waste stream annually.
In a flash, I had multiple friends asking if I wanted more linens to use for blankets. It’s been so rewarding to see them turned into new weighted blankets that are well-loved.

Materials used:
US 17 circular needles with a 60” cable
Any and all rescued bedsheets (fitted and flat both work!), pillowcases, and other linens on hand
Yarn needle for weaving in ends
Scissors
